The information within the Ms355 Datasheet is typically organized into several key sections, each serving a vital purpose:
- Electrical Characteristics: This covers crucial parameters like voltage requirements, current consumption, and operating frequencies.
- Timing Diagrams: Visual representations that illustrate the sequence and timing of signals, essential for understanding how the component interacts with other parts of a circuit.
- Pin Descriptions: A clear explanation of each pin's function, allowing for correct connections.
- Application Notes: Practical advice and examples on how to best utilize the MS355 in various scenarios.
